Then learn important and practical information about design for aging in place with the following presentation by Glen Boudreaux, ASID, RID, IDS, CCT, RIM, BVCC of Boudreaux Associates:

Accessibility for the Luxury Market, Designing With Compassion
[HSW | Session will count as a CEPH for continuing education requirements for Texas Registered Interior Designers and can be self-reported as a CEU to IDCEC.]
In this seminar, we will look at Universal Design and Accessibility as it relates to aging in place. We will look at techniques for approaching a client's limitations with compassion, not sympathy. Gain insight into ways to approach barrier-free design from a different point of view and direction. Designing with Compassion can change how clients perceive you by approaching the design process in a different way and have them know, like and trust you more.
